King of Swords


Meaning

The King of Swords tarot card represents the qualities of clear thinking, rationality, and intellectual power. It signifies a time to make decisions based on logic and reason rather than emotions or feelings. The King of Swords encourages us to be objective and fair in our dealings with others and to use our intellect to solve problems. It’s a card of leadership, authority, and the importance of making informed decisions.

Symbolism

The King of Swords is often depicted as a figure sitting on a throne, holding a sword in his hand. This represents the sense of justice and fairness, as well as the need for objectivity. The figure is often dressed in clothes that symbolise power and authority, which indicates that the future is promising. The sword, on the other hand, symbolises the power of intellect and the potential for knowledge and wisdom. The King of Swords is a reminder to use our intelligence and our ability to reason to make the best decisions.

Reverse Meaning

When the King of Swords appears in reverse in a tarot reading, it can indicate a lack of clarity or confusion. It might suggest that we are not thinking clearly or that our judgments are clouded by emotions or personal biases. The reverse King of Swords can also indicate a lack of leadership or authority, which may be holding us back from making important decisions. We may need to take a step back and reevaluate our thought processes before we can move forward. However, it’s important to remember the importance of using our intelligence to make rational decisions. The reverse King of Swords is a reminder to trust our intellect, to be objective and rational, and to use our wisdom to make informed decisions.
